Instrument cluster with
enhanced features: setting the
operating mode
Concept
Depending on the equipment, the instrument
cluster can be set to three different operating
modes in addition to the driving mode.
Adjusting
Via iDrive:
1. "My Vehicle".
2. "iDrive settings".
3. "Displays".
4. "Instrument panel".
5. Select the desired setting:
- "STANDARD": all displays on the instrument
cluster are active.
- "REDUCED" all displays on the instrument
cluster are reduced to the essential.
- "INDIVIDUAL": all displays on the instrument
cluster are active. Individual displays
can be individually selected.
Configuring INDIVIDUAL
- "Driving mode display": when the driving
mode is switched into ECO PRO or SPORT,
the instrument cluster automatically switches
into the respective view.
- "Speed limit exceeded": if the speed recognized
by Speed Limit Info is exceeded, the
exceeded range is marked red in the speedometer.
Instrument cluster without
enhanced features: selecting
displays in the instrument
cluster
Via iDrive:
1. "My Vehicle".
2. "iDrive settings".
3. "Displays".
4. "Instrument panel".
5. Select the desired setting:
- With navigation system:
"Navigation": display the arrow view for
the navigation in the instrument cluster.
- "Road signs": display Speed Limit Info.
